Pros

Great colleagues! HiBob brings in some very quality candidates, the surrounding teams are friendly, talented, and ambitious. The HR space is interesting and there is a lot to learn if you apply yourself.

Cons

Non transparent leadership which results in very different internal/external messages. Everything HiBob has to offer sounds good on paper, but the reality of working there is much different. The office politics are cliquey and there is a lot of gossip at the highest level of leadership. The sales targets do not fit the reachable audience causing a variety of different expectations on a weekly basis. Employee expectations are unrealistic and based on the constant changing standards.

Pros

- Lots of smart, fun, hardworking people. It's a really great vibe when we all get together - Nice office in Chelsea with standing desks, coffee/snacks, and lunch on Wednesdays - Lots of opportunities for training and access to industry events - Unique product that's shaking up the HR tech industry. Product regularly releases updates to help us compete in the US market

Cons

- The blend of hybrid and fully-remote work in the US makes it tough to feel like one team. Not unique to HiBob with so many people now working remotely - There's been a lot of sales turnover in the last year but it feels like things are starting to turn around. The reduced quotas are a huge step in the right direction - Getting things done with the team in Israel can be hard and clunky. Simple processes take longer than they should to get done

Pros

Great product offering! that’s constantly undergoing evaluation and improvement. And colleagues are generally a pleasure and amazing to work with

Cons

There is NO ROOM for growth in this organization! If you are seeking to leverage sales as a catalyst for career growth and development – then this company is not for you. There is no career mapping of any sort, and absolutely no infrastructure for internal mobility regardless of department but most emphatically in sales – including top performers. Sales managers are very experienced and knowledgeable but can be a bit nefarious and manipulative. The company spouts and regurgitates “diversity of thought” but is woefully unreceptive using fear and force to garner output and performance - which will always backfire and has! Not to mention, no discretionary bonuses, no accelerators, and sometimes your success is overlooked altogether. Lastly, mass firing of talent instead of just doing layoffs like other tech companies - all to overcompensate for the poor results of the ineffective implementation of strategic moves is laughable. There are a ton of strategic initiatives, which is good. However, the timing and implementation of those initiatives leaves much to be desired. Timing is everything. To implement major internal changes on the precipice of an economic crisis is not wise. We can have all the analytics and market data in world, but it will never compensate for common sense which leadership seems to lack. Overall, there is a ton of lip-service and that’s all.

Thank you for your review. You touched on several topics, so we’ll try to address each of your points as well as possible. First of all, we are super committed to our team's development, which is why we run our HiGrowth feedback process twice a year. This process provides dedicated time for employees and managers to discuss and create a plan for growth and career development. We also recently introduced two new job levels (Senior BDR and Associate Account Executive) to enable more mobility within the sales department. We are incredibly proud to have promoted two BDRs to the Associate AE role in January under this model, and we have a similar growth pathway within the Customer Success org. Long-term, we also plan to build cross-functional career paths, but we haven’t reached the stage of business maturity to support this model just yet. While we wish we could promote all of our top performers, business needs and budget sometimes impede our ability to promote all those who deserve it. This is especially true under the current market conditions. However, we are big believers that skills training, leadership development, and job enrichment can be as meaningful to employees as promotion, and we’ve invested heavily into these types of programs to keep our Bobbers engaged, motivated, and learning. Those who are promoted here are vetted carefully both for their individual performance contributions as well as their leadership qualities and alignment with HiBob’s values. To your point about compensation, you’re correct that we don’t offer discretionary bonuses to our salespeople. Our sales compensation model, like most companies in our industry, consists of a base salary, commissions, stock options, and SPIFFs. Our sales compensation plan also applies accelerators for Account Executives who overachieve against their quotas. And to your final point, you’re absolutely right. We have implemented many new initiatives in the past year. Our business is changing fast, and so we’ve needed to shift quickly to ensure our long-term success. We know this can be painful in the short-term, and we do our best to minimize the impact on our people, but we can always do better. In conjunction with these strategic initiatives, we’ve also had to say goodbye to several members of our sales team. None of these decisions have been made lightly, but performance metrics and business needs have been at the root of all our actions.
